About this episode
Apple may be developing a revamped Health app with a built-in AI doctor, Apple is reportedly on track to launch the M5 iPad Pro and MacBook Pro later this year, and Google’s new experimental AI model, Gemini 2.5 Pro, is now available to free users too.
